On March 13, Rep. Emilia Sykes, D-Akron, sent a letter to HATCo CEO Dr. Marc Harrison raising concerns about the proposed acquisition of Summa Health.
Summa Health is a nonprofit integrated healthcare delivery system in Northeast Ohio, United States. [1] The Greater Akron Chamber (Ohio) [2] documents Summa Health as the largest employer in Summit County with more than 7,000 employees.

Thomas J. Strauss, Pharm.D. is the President and CEO of Summa Health System, in Ohio. Prior to joining Summa Health System in 1999, Strauss was the president of Meridia Health Services in Cleveland (which later merged with Cleveland Clinic Health System).
